Excellent, innovative and quirky camera systems made and marketed by a gigantic disinterested corporation.

I've got a significant amount of Contax equipment myself, including the G2 system. IMHO the image quality out of these little cameras is unbeaten in the 35mm world. An inexpensive film/slide scanner such as one of the Dimage Scan Dual-series gives a good and relatively inexpensive into the digital realm. It's worth a look if you're not worried about getting your prints or postings the same day.

The attractions of digicams are their instant gratification and their unparalled macro capabilities. Most seem to scrimp on the lenses, meaning you can narrow down the field pretty quickly if you want Zeiss-like quality. With the Sonys, I've not seen any of their very compact models supplied with T* Zeiss lenses. If there is one, I'd recommend a look
(although I've not heard whether their digicams have inherited Sony's typical mediocre dependability). Panasonic are putting Leitz lenses on their better models, and of all companies, Kodak uses Schnieder lenses on their better models. My wife just ebay-'d a Kodak LS443 4 meg with a 3x Schneider zoom and a docking port for less than three hundred bucks. The quality is very good and it's a reasonably small camera.

Shutter lag, slow startup time difficulty seeing the screen outdoors, lack of true manual focus, lack of true wide angle optics, weak flash, poor optical finders...are some of the frustrating shortcomings of digicams I've used. Some of these areas are being addressed, others not really.

Don't get overly hung up on megapixels. A 4-meg low-noise chip will give better images than a noisy 5-meg chip, and as a consumer it's very difficult to make a useful comparison.

If I were buying today, I'd seriously consider the Camedia 5060 because of it's (very rare) wide angle zoom. But it is neither inexpensive nor compact.
